📖 Meet a new word while reading? Tap it — it's yours

Whenever you're reading inside TuTu — a class page, or one of the Kwaidan ghost stories in your 📚 Reading Library — you don't need a separate dictionary app.

  • Select a single word on the page.

  • A little card pops up with the meaning.

  • Tap 📓 Save, and the word goes straight into your My Study Bank — along with the name of the page or story you found it in, so you'll always remember where you met it.

That's it. Keep reading; the word waits for you. ✨

✍️ Found a sentence you love? Save the whole passage

Some things are bigger than a word — a beautiful sentence, a phrase you want to steal for your own writing (the good kind of stealing 😉).

  • Select the whole passage instead of one word.

  • Tap save, and add your own note — why it caught you, or how you might use it.

  • It lands in My Study Bank as a saved passage, quote + your note + the page it came from, with a little ↩ back to the page link so you can revisit it in context anytime.

Collecting sentences you admire is one of the oldest, best writer's habits there is — and now it's one tap. 🍓

📁 Give your collection some shelves

Once your Study Bank starts filling up (it will!), you can tidy it:

  • Put entries into groups — "UP2 words," "debate phrases," "Kwaidan," whatever makes sense to you.

  • Filter by group to review just one topic at a time.

  • And here's my favorite part — remember the 🃏 Flashcards I introduced last time? You can now import a whole group into a deck in one tap. Read → save → group → drill. A complete little study loop, all yours. 🥕

✏️ TuTu's English Corner

  • slip away — (気づかないうちに)消えていく・逃げていく。To be lost or forgotten without you noticing. "No word you meet has to slip away."

  • catch you — 心をつかむ・引きつける。When something grabs your attention or moves you. "Why it caught you."

  • underway — 進行中で。Already started and in progress. "The final projects are underway."

  • a makeover — 模様替え・イメージチェンジ。A change that makes something look fresh and better organized. "Your menu got a makeover."

  • do its thing — (それ自体の)役目を果たす・好きにさせておく。To let something happen naturally without worrying about it. "The rain will do its thing; you do yours."
